Michael Schuster | Fresh and mineral to smell; an elegant, linear, middleweight, with a very gentle tannin; fresh, sweet-fruited, infused with a marked mineral element; long, vibrant, and with excellent aromatic persistence. Freshness, finesse, aroma, and a delicious vitality on the gently sweet fruit. Like many of the wines this vintage, this is lacking the commune’s characteristic flesh and is thus not obviously Pomerol—nor obviously Merlot from Pomerol. But this is a lovely wine nonetheless. A fifth of the usual crop! 2019–28. | 17
